نمایش نتایج 1 تا 7 از 7

نام تاپیک: جلوگیری از اجرای cmd در هنگام اجرای پروژه

  1. #1

    جلوگیری از اجرای cmd در هنگام اجرای پروژه

    سلام چطور میشه از اینکه cmd در هنگام اجرای پروژه باز شه جلوگیری کرد برای برنامه هایی که نیازی به رابط cmd ندارن؟

  2. #2
    کاربر تازه وارد آواتار sd702004
    تاریخ عضویت
    مرداد 1398
    محل زندگی
    مشهد
    پست
    40

    نقل قول: جلوگیری از اجرای cmd در هنگام اجرای پروژه

    اگه از Visual Studio استفاده می‌کنید یک روش برای این کار اینه که از قسمت تنظیمات، بخش Linker > System گزینه SubSystem رو در حالت Windows قرار بدین و تابع main رو هم به این شکل تغییر بدین:
    #include <Windows.h>

    int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, LPSTR pCmdLine, int nCmdShow){
    return 0;
    }


    البته روشهای دیگه ای هم برای این کار وجود داره

  3. #3

    نقل قول: جلوگیری از اجرای cmd در هنگام اجرای پروژه

    ممنون از جوابتون ولی من از ویژوال استودیو استفاده نمی کنم و برنامه ام هم از کتاب خانه windows استفاده نمی کنه آیا راه حل دیگه ای وجود نداره؟

  4. #4

    نقل قول: جلوگیری از اجرای cmd در هنگام اجرای پروژه

    نقل قول نوشته شده توسط NimaGP مشاهده تاپیک
    ممنون از جوابتون ولی من از ویژوال استودیو استفاده نمی کنم و برنامه ام هم از کتاب خانه windows استفاده نمی کنه آیا راه حل دیگه ای وجود نداره؟
    دقیقا از چی استفاده میکنید ؟میخواید چکار کنید ؟

  5. #5

    نقل قول: جلوگیری از اجرای cmd در هنگام اجرای پروژه

    نقل قول نوشته شده توسط pe32_64 مشاهده تاپیک
    دقیقا از چی استفاده میکنید ؟میخواید چکار کنید ؟
    من از netbeans استفاده می کنم برنامه ام فقط یه اشاره گر ساده به یه فایل jar هست البته این کار رو برای برنامه دیگه ام نیاز دارم و ممنون می شم راهنمایی کنید

  6. #6
    کاربر تازه وارد آواتار sd702004
    تاریخ عضویت
    مرداد 1398
    محل زندگی
    مشهد
    پست
    40

    نقل قول: جلوگیری از اجرای cmd در هنگام اجرای پروژه

    فکر میکنم از کامپایلر GCC استفاده میکنید. اگر همین طوره اینجا روش کار رو توضیح داده

  7. #7

    نقل قول: جلوگیری از اجرای cmd در هنگام اجرای پروژه

    نقل قول نوشته شده توسط sd702004 مشاهده تاپیک
    فکر میکنم از کامپایلر GCC استفاده میکنید. اگر همین طوره اینجا روش کار رو توضیح داده
    خیلی ممنون کار کرد برای دوستان دیگه ای هم که از GCC و G++ استفاده میکنن و حوصله رفتن به اون لینک رو ندارن عبارت
    -mwindows
    رو به دستور کامپایل اضافه کنن و باز هم خیلی ممنون لازم داشتم



ق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•